Output 313e03a15c24724e84b740626be323bf65f43c68db52d6e43161f693e4ea91f2:1

value
635795
script pubkey
OP_0 OP_PUSHBYTES_20 15080ea7ba29d45caf3671e1aac52c5c0a230c9e
address
bc1qz5yqafa69829etekw8s643fvts9zxry780gx3u
transaction
313e03a15c24724e84b740626be323bf65f43c68db52d6e43161f693e4ea91f2
spent
true